What is Ipamorelin?
Ipamorelin is a synthetic pentapeptide (Aib-His-D-2-Nal-D-Phe-Lys-NH₂) that acts as a selective agonist of the growth-hormone secretagogue receptor (GHS-R1a, the ghrelin receptor). It stimulates pulsatile growth-hormone release from pituitary somatotrophs without significant effect on ACTH, cortisol or prolactin in published models — the basis for its classification as a ‘selective GHRP’.

Ipamorelin Mechanism of Action
- Acts as a selective agonist of the growth-hormone secretagogue receptor (GHS-R1a, the ghrelin receptor) on pituitary somatotrophs.
- Stimulates pulsatile growth-hormone release without significant effect on ACTH, cortisol, or prolactin in published models — the basis for its ‘selective GHRP’ classification.
- Synergizes with GHRH-receptor agonists (e.g. CJC-1295, sermorelin) on GH release in paired secretagogue studies.
- Acts through Gq/PLC signaling and intracellular calcium mobilization in receptor-expressing cell models.
- The Aib and D-amino-acid residues confer protease resistance relative to native ghrelin-derived sequences.
- Carries no melanocortin or opioid receptor activity, isolating GHS-R1a pharmacology as a research tool.
Ipamorelin Research Applications
- GHS-R1a receptor-binding and activation assays in receptor-expressing cell lines.
- Pituitary somatotroph GH-release studies in cell-culture and rodent models.
- Comparative GHRP vs GHRH secretagogue synergy experiments.
- Calcium-mobilization and Gq/PLC signaling assays.
- Selectivity profiling against ACTH, cortisol, and prolactin readouts.
- Structure-activity studies of GHS-R1a pentapeptide agonists.
